Question
Who can issue Sovereign Gold Bonds?
Solution
SGBs are government securities denominated in grams of gold . They are substitutes for holding physical gold . Investors have to pay the issue price in cash and the bonds will be redeemed in cash on maturity . The Bond is issued by Reserve Bank on behalf of Government of India .
